Telesitters are CNAs or hands-off Companions that observe patients at risk for self-harm or other safety issues through a system of remote visual monitoring cameras. The observation room is in-house but removed from the patients' rooms. They are responsible for monitoring patients for self-harm, elopement and fall risks, and other patients who require monitoring. Telesitters view patients in real-time, cameras do not record. Telesitters can talk with the patients through the system to ask them not to get out of bed, not to pull at a device, to wait until the nurse comes, etc. but do not interact with patients face to face.
• Position Summary
• Under supervision of a Registered Professional Nurse and according to established policies and procedures, uses the remote visual monitoring system to observe the patients and provide supervision to 10-12 patients at a time for a number of safety related reasons. The first line of action will be to verbally redirect the patient from engaging in any at risk behaviors. Next will be to summon the nursing staff if the patient requires assistance. Monitor staff will be knowledgeable and abide by patient and institutional confidentiality. The Companion Telesitter will maintain an orderly monitoring station, document events and any changes to observation expectations within the monitoring system. Consideration of the special needs and behaviors of specific patient populations is required. Will be used as a clinical resource to unlicensed telesitters. Will help to maintain lists for equal distribution of monitored patients.
